package dependency_injection_with_annotations.loaders;
import java.io.File;
import java.io.IOException;
import java.util.ArrayList;
import java.util.Collections;
import java.util.Enumeration;
import java.util.List;
import java.util.jar.JarEntry;
import java.util.jar.JarFile;
/**
* This sample code demonstrates how to look into the contents of a JAR file
*
* @author Roger
* @Date 16/9/11
*/
public class JarLoader {
private final List<File> directories;
private final String packageName;
private final List<Class<?>> classes;
public JarLoader(List<File> directories, String packageName) throws ClassNotFoundException, IOException {
this.directories = directories;
this.packageName = packageName;
classes = findAllClasses();
}
public static final JarLoader getInstance(List<File> directories, String packageName) throws ClassNotFoundException,
IOException {
return new JarLoader(directories, packageName);
}
public static final JarLoader getInstance(File directory, String packageName) throws ClassNotFoundException, IOException {
List<File> list = new ArrayList<File>();
list.add(directory);
return getInstance(list, packageName);
}
public List<Class<?>> findAllClasses() throws IOException, ClassNotFoundException {
List<Class<?>> classes = new ArrayList<Class<?>>();
for (File directory : directories) {
classes.addAll(walkJar(directory));
}
return classes;
}
private List<Class<?>> walkJar(File directory) throws IOException, ClassNotFoundException {
List<Class<?>> classes = new ArrayList<Class<?>>();
JarFile jarFile = new JarFile(directory);
Enumeration<JarEntry> jarEntries = jarFile.entries();
while (jarEntries.hasMoreElements()) {
JarEntry jarEntry = jarEntries.nextElement();
addClassFromJar(jarEntry, classes);
}
return classes;
}
private void addClassFromJar(JarEntry jarEntry, List<Class<?>> classes) {
if (isMatchingClass(jarEntry)) {
String fileName = jarEntry.getName();
if (isValidClassName(fileName)) {
Class<?> clazz = createClass(fileName);
if (isNotNull(clazz)) {
classes.add(clazz);
}
}
}
}
private boolean isMatchingClass(JarEntry jarEntry) {
boolean retVal = false;
if (!jarEntry.isDirectory()) {
// String name = jarEntry.getName();
// TODO Fix this
// Matcher matcher = pattern.matcher(name);
retVal = true;
// retVal = matcher.matches();
}
return retVal;
}
private boolean isValidClassName(String fileName) {
return fileName.endsWith(".class") && !fileName.contains("$");
}
private Class<?> createClass(String fileName) {
try {
String className = getClassName(fileName);
return Class.forName(className);
} catch (Throwable e) {
e.printStackTrace();
return null;
}
}
private String getClassName(final String fileName) {
String retVal = fileName.substring(0, fileName.length() - 6);
retVal = retVal.replaceAll("/", ".");
return retVal;
}
private boolean isNotNull(Object obj) {
return obj != null;
}
public List<Class<?>> getClasses() {
return Collections.unmodifiableList(classes);
}
public String getPackageName() {
return packageName;
}
}
